Understanding Coral Calcium – Nature’s Balanced Mineral Complex
What Is AQUACAL™ Coral Calcium Powder?
AQUACAL™ Coral Calcium Powder is a pharmaceutical-grade marine calcium ingredient derived exclusively from dead, fossilized coral reefs located above sea level. These coral formations were created over centuries by marine organisms that absorbed ionic minerals from seawater and deposited them into reef structures. Over time, geological processes transformed these deposits into naturally mineralized calcium carbonate matrices.
Unlike harvested live coral, fossilized coral calcium is ethically sourced, environmentally responsible, and fully compliant with international sustainability norms.
AQUACAL™ delivers highly bioavailable calcium carbonate naturally enriched with up to 74 trace minerals, making it exceptionally suitable for bone and joint health formulations.

The Science Behind Marine-Derived Calcium Absorption
Structural Advantages Over Conventional Calcium Carbonate
Unlike limestone-derived calcium carbonate, coral calcium possesses a porous, fibrous microstructure. This structure allows coral calcium to naturally ionize in the presence of moisture, enabling faster dissociation into absorbable calcium ions within the digestive tract.
Scientific advantages include:
- Improved solubility at physiological pH
- Natural presence of magnesium, phosphorus, and trace elements
- Reduced risk of gastrointestinal irritation
- Enhanced mineral transport across intestinal membranes
Because of these characteristics, coral calcium for bone health is increasingly adopted by nutraceutical and pharmaceutical brands seeking clinically relevant performance, not just label claims.
Bone and Joint Health – The Core Driver of Calcium Demand
Bone and joint disorders represent one of the largest and fastest-growing global healthcare segments. Aging populations, sedentary lifestyles, vitamin D deficiency, and mineral imbalances have intensified the demand for effective calcium supplementation.
However, calcium efficacy depends not only on dosage but on absorption efficiency, retention, and mineral synergy.
Calcium’s Role in Bone Density and Regeneration
Calcium is essential for:
- Bone mineralization
- Hydroxyapatite crystal formation
- Osteoblast activation
- Long-term skeletal strength
Highly bioavailable sources like coral calcium ensure that a greater proportion of ingested calcium is retained in bone tissue rather than excreted, improving formulation efficiency and long-term outcomes.
